Re: Demptronic NFL Football
It seems to run on 2.2.3 if I switch to "Old PPU".
The new PPU is supposed to be much more accurate, but I'm not sure specifically in what ways.
The default setting is old PPU, but I think it's mainly that way to provide support for legacy TAS etc. that relies on its behaviour. If you're trying to develop new software, you would probably want to use new PPU.

Re: Demptronic NFL Football
It's basically just like the NMI handler, but rather than only happening at the very top of the frame, in the MMC5's case, you instead tell it to start an IRQ at scanline N. I'm not certain what a programmed value of "0" means here. It could mean the prerender scanline ... or it could mean something else.raydempsey wrote:I've never used IRQs before. [...] Not sure how to implement IRQs. Sounds like I should switch. I bet it would be easier to do other effects too. Any thoughts?
You also need to explicitly acknowledge the IRQ source in the IRQ handler (i.e. read $5204), whereas NMIs don't need to be.
(As contrast, the MMC3 starts an IRQ after N scanlines have passed)

Re: Demptronic NFL Football
If the wiki is right then
"
IRQ Counter ($5203) = All eight bits specify the scanline number to generate IRQ at
When the MMC5 detects a scanline, the following events occur:
if the In Frame signal is clear, set it, reset the IRQ counter to 0, and clear the IRQ Pending flag
otherwise, increment the IRQ counter. If it now equals the IRQ scanline ($5203), raise IRQ Pending flag
Note the above logic makes it impossible for an IRQ to occur when $5203 (IRQ counter) is set to $00"
I'm pretty sure when I did my MMC3 to MMC5 conversion I remember I had to change almost all the places where it was loading a 00 into the IRQ register into 01's.

Re: Demptronic NFL Football
For your purposes, I think you should just be able to have an IRQ that does something like
In your main thread, make sure you've disabled other sources of IRQs (APU frame counter and DMC completion), told the 6502 to listen to IRQs (CLI), and in your NMI, tell the MMC5 to start the IRQ at the right scanline (LDA #something / STA $5203) and tell the MMC5 to enable IRQs (LDA #$80 / STA $5204)
Code: Select all
PHA
TXA
PHA
LDA $5204 ; acknowledge IRQ
LDA #0
STA $5204 ; MAYBE UNNECESSARY - disable IRQ so that it won't happen later unless it was re-enabled every vblank in the NMI)
LDA shadow_nametable
STA $2006
LDA shadow_Y
STA $2005
(insert some specific delay here so that the scroll split will happen at the right place on-screen)
LDX shadow_X
LDA shadow_last
STX $2005
STA $2006
PLA
TAX
PLA
RTI

Re: Demptronic NFL Football
Somewhere in your fixed bank, and the IRQ vector should point to it (next to the NMI and RESET vectors).raydempsey wrote:I've experimented with the code suggested by lidnariq but I'm not sure where to put it.
After than, setting up IRQs should be as simple as:
* In your main thread:
CLI
* In your NMI
lda #scanline_to_generate_IRQ_at
sta $5203
lda #$80
sta $5204
